Chickpeas

Chickpeas, also known as garbanzo beans, are small, round legumes with a nutty flavor and firm texture. They are rich in protein, fiber, vitamins, and minerals, making them a nutritious addition to various dishes. Often used in salads, stews, hummus, and snacks, chickpeas are versatile and support digestive health, help regulate blood sugar levels, and promote satiety. They are naturally gluten-free, suitable for vegetarian and vegan diets, and contribute to a balanced, plant-based diet. Their mild taste and hearty consistency make them popular worldwide in a variety of culinary traditions.
